ON THE RIGHT: REBECCA SCHIFFMAN
Vice: Do you remember Ryan taking that picture?
Rebecca Schiffman: Vaguely. We were just having fun being foxes. Ryan had us do so much crazy stuff, so it’s all a blur. There was a lot of jumping off cliffs into water and stuff. I especially remember having to walk through bushes naked. That was particularly alien to me, being from the city… All these prickly leaves itching you.
Tell us a bit about yourself.
I’m a musician and a painter. My dad’s a Reconstructionist rabbi. I do a zine about the Upper East Side called the UES Journal. I’m from there, and after going to college at Cooper Union I got so sick of downtown that I moved back uptown and now I love it there. I feel like I discovered it anew.
Lily told me about how you were terrorized by a doll.
Oh god, yeah, it was an American Girl doll. The “Samantha.” It was a terrifying presence in my house my whole childhood. I would have to run past it. Finally I put an ad on Craigslist offering it up for free. I didn’t want any blood money for it.
Now you tell me a funny story about Lily.
On the road trip we were playing this dumb game called “How Hard Can You Hit Yourself?” It was just all of us going around in a circle, taking turns punching and slapping ourselves. I remember Lily was the most fearless, even more so than the boys. Even after everyone else stopped she just kept going, punching herself in the face really hard. We were all cracking up. The next day she had a black eye and I think that’s the black eye she has in the picture that was on the cover of the Vice Photo Issue last year.
